E85 is roughly 105 RM Octane as mentioned above, the other benefits are it's increased cooling charge capacity coupled with lower EGT's. We run this stuff in our race car and make the same power we did with Q16 with faster spool up and transient response as well as our EGT's now are nearly 200f lower.
